Definition of Van Chevron Kits
Chevron kits are distinctive markings created to help vehicles stand out on the road. They are often used on emergency vehicles such as ambulances, fire engines, and police units, but can also be applied to commercial vans. The design usually includes reflective “V” shapes positioned on the back and sides.
The primary function is improved road safety. By increasing visibility, they help other drivers identify the vehicle more easily, particularly in poor lighting or bad weather.

Van Wraps: A Practical and Flexible Choice
Van wraps are vinyl coverings applied to part or all of a vehicle’s exterior. They allow for noticeable visual changes while also protecting the original paint. This can help maintain the vehicle’s condition and value over time.
They allow ongoing visibility for branding during everyday use. They can be removed cleanly, allowing easy changes when needed.
